Green Day's song "Outsider" delves into profound themes of alienation, defiance, and the quest for acceptance. The recurring refrain "Oh I'm an outsider outside of everything" encapsulates the pervasive sense of detachment and isolation experienced by the song's narrator. Through these repetitive lyrics, the track poignantly articulates the sensation of standing on the outskirts of society, peering in from the margins.

The repetition of the phrase "everything you know" serves to deepen the portrayal of the narrator's disconnect from the world around them. This recurrence underscores the stark juxtaposition between the outsider's perspective and the familiar landscape they observe but feel estranged from, amplifying the feeling of disconnection and estrangement.

Within the verses, the narrator conveys feelings of frustration and resentment towards those who attempt to assert control or diminish their worth. Lines such as "Everybody's gotta push me, push me around" and "Everybody tried to put me, tried to put me down" resonate with individuals who grapple with feelings of marginalization or misunderstanding.

Despite encountering myriad challenges, the narrator maintains an unyielding spirit of defiance, steadfastly refusing to conform to societal expectations or norms. The declaration "I messed up everyone, I've already had all my fun" exudes a palpable sense of rebellion and nonconformity, signaling the narrator's refusal to be constrained by the judgments of others.

The recurring assertion "I've already had all my fun" serves as a potent affirmation of the narrator's autonomy and self-assurance. These lyrics convey a profound sense of liberation, suggesting that the narrator has lived life on their own terms and is unapologetic about any repercussions or criticisms they may face as a result.

In essence, "Outsider" by Green Day emerges as a stirring anthem for individuals who have grappled with feelings of estrangement and non-belonging. Through its raw emotional intensity and unwavering lyrical honesty, the song captures the essence of the outsider experience, celebrating the resilience and fortitude required to embrace one's uniqueness in a world often characterized by conformity and convention.
